FACS assay depending on weighty- and light-chain assemblies provided insights to the optimum antibody expression in CHO cells by first doing a two-shade sorting of environmentally friendly fluorescent protein and yellow fluorescent genes that fused with recombinant antibody significant- and light-weight-chain genes, respectively (Sleiman et al., 2010). Fluorescent fusion antibody chains are co-expressed by IRES-dependent vectors. twin fluorescent clones chosen by FACS confirmed a 38-fold boost in antibody manufacturing within 12 weeks relative to that in their parent pool.

in recent times, with the event of microfluidic technologies, the single cell separation by h2o-in-oil is now A lot more experienced. It provides a completely unique impressive know-how System for increasing the traditional method of separating one cells. The sphere fluidics made by Cyto-Mine® is often a substantial-throughput microfluidic solitary-cell Examination and screening method, which works by using the droplet wrapping technologies to quickly independent and wrap A huge number of single cells in a brief the perfect time to sort numerous pores and skin liters of small droplets, producing Every single droplet an unbiased process for cell lifestyle and detection of solitary cells (Josephides et al., 2020). By detecting the expression and secretion level of single cells, the cells with the highest antibody expression stage is often promptly detected and screened inside a several several hours, and then sorted right into a different perfectly in the tradition plate.
